--- makefile.orig Tue Feb 18 20:58:28 2003 +++ makefile Thu Mar 27 20:58:31 2003 @@ -32,6 +32,6 @@ SUFF= else ifneq (,$(findstring FreeBSD,$(OSTYPE))) -TFLAGS=-pthread -THRLIBS= +TFLAGS=-D_REENTRANT ${PTHREAD_CFLAGS} +THRLIBS=${PTHREAD_LIBS} else @@ -65,7 +65,7 @@ WEB_EXAMPLES = cgistub bugdb clidb -CC = g++ +CC = ${CXX} # Possible FastDB compile time parameters (-Dxxx should be added to DEFS macro): # 1. USE_LOCALE_SETTINGS - use C locale for string comparison operations @@ -101,13 +101,13 @@ DEFS = -DUSE_QUEUE_MANAGER -DUSE_LOCALE_SETTINGS #CFLAGS = $(TFLAGS) -c -Wall -O5 -g $(DEFS) -CFLAGS = -c -Wall -O0 -g $(DEFS) $(TFLAGS) +CFLAGS = -c ${CXXFLAGS} $(DEFS) $(TFLAGS) #CFLAGS = -c -Wall -O0 -DFASTDB_DEBUG=DEBUG_TRACE -g $(DEFS) $(TFLAGS) -SHFLAGS=-shared +SHFLAGS = -shared -Wl,-soname,$@ LD = $(CC) -LDFLAGS = -g $(TFLAGS) +LDFLAGS = $(TFLAGS) AR = ar ARFLAGS = -cru @@ -326,18 +326,15 @@ install: subsql installlib mkdir -p $(BINSPATH) - cp subsql $(BINSPATH) - strip $(BINSPATH)/subsql + ${BSD_INSTALL_PROGRAM} subsql $(BINSPATH) installlib: $(FASTDB_LIB) $(CLI_LIB) $(FASTDB_SHARED) $(CLI_SHARED) mkdir -p $(INCSPATH) - cp $(INCS) $(INCSPATH) + ${BSD_INSTALL_DATA} $(INCS) $(INCSPATH) mkdir -p $(LIBSPATH) - cp $(FASTDB_LIB) $(CLI_LIB) $(FASTDB_SHARED) $(CLI_SHARED) $(LIBSPATH) + ${BSD_INSTALL_PROGRAM} $(FASTDB_LIB) $(CLI_LIB) $(FASTDB_SHARED) $(CLI_SHARED) $(LIBSPATH) cd $(LIBSPATH); ln -f -s $(FASTDB_SHARED) libfastdb$(SUFF).so cd $(LIBSPATH); ln -f -s $(CLI_SHARED) libcli$(SUFF).so - - uninstall: rm -fr $(INCSPATH)